2012-02-26 5 views
0

私はVisualSearch.jsを使用しています。すぐに使えますが、私のインターフェースにはリンクのリストがあります。ユーザーがこれらのいずれかをクリックすると、ファセット&(つまりタグ:cats)が検索ボックスに追加され、すでに存在する他の検索入力を考慮して検索がトリガーされます。VisualSearch.jsでファセットと値をプログラムで追加する

ソースコードからこれを行う明確な方法はありません - 何か不足していますか? http://documentcloud.github.com/visualsearch助けてくれてありがとう!

答えて

1

私はそれを考え出し - visualSearch.jsからaddFacet法を用いて - このような:

//タグフィルター visualSearch.searchBox.addFacet( 'タグ'、tag.name、0)を加えます。

+0

あなたは明確にできますか?タグで参照しているオブジェクトがわかりません.name - この関数に何を渡しても、エラーが表示されます - >プロパティ 'type'が未定義です – derrylwc

0

あなたは以下のようなsearch_box.jsにaddFacet機能を見つける必要があります:

addFacet : function(category, initialQuery, position) { 

「カテゴリは」「initialQueryは」事前移入値となり、面の名前になります。

関連する問題